Synopsis

Mr. Whicher is hired by former Home Secretary Sir Edward Shore to investigate the violent threats made against his son Charles, who has recently returned from India with his family. Cast & Characters

  • Paddy Considine as Mr. Whicher
  • Nancy Carroll as Mrs. Piper
  • John Heffernan as Captain Charles Shore
  • Laura Morgan as Katherine Shore
  • Nicholas Jones as Sir Edward Shore
  • Kate Fahy as Georgina Shore
  • Ellora Torchia as Miss Khan / Zeenat Jabour
  • Akshay Kumar as Roshan Jabour
  • Adrian Quinton as Asim Jabour
  • Tim Pigott-Smith as Commissioner Mayne
